Java根据page、pageSize截取数组(非util)

问题描述

Java根据page、pageSize截取数组(非util)

List<T> list = xxx;

int fromIndex = (page - 1)*pageSize + 1;
int toIndex = (fromIndex + pageSize < list.size())? fromIndex + pageSize : list.size()+1;
List<T> pageList = list.subList(fromIndex - 1, toIndex - 1);

qaq

你可能感兴趣的:(学习总结,学习,java)